Transaction 84aba119c87aed09518039576f1c4c7ff7a0ea2e83f789459d32eb1d7a3a2cba
1 Input
1 Output
-
84aba119c87aed09518039576f1c4c7ff7a0ea2e83f789459d32eb1d7a3a2cba:0
- value
- 1604272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1e9ffb66e44219c6dd40869a1dc63e16dc02950 OP_EQUAL
- address
- 3LpwUARkQXLhGMyyF5a2DbC5uSfmtaSnqe